The Riverview Hotel sits smack bang between the Bass Coast and the iconic Wilsons Promontory.
Incorporating a spacious public bar, lounge/dining areas and function areas, lovely deck area and beer garden, perfect for large crowds and live music plus a 2 bedroom residence.
Visitors can enjoy lunch at the Riverview Hotel after a kayak or a fish over the road in the Tarwin River or a surf down the road at Venus Bay.
The property is set on an approx. 3,231m2 (TZ) land allotment and boasts a building area of approx. 985m2.
Over the last few years, the Riverview Hotel has seen a major upgrade undertaken. Whilst the front part of the building is still quite original, the kitchen, bar, restrooms, and bistro have all had a superb upgrade.

The size of Tarwin Lower is approximately 206.4 square kilometres. It has 1 park covering nearly 8.8% of total area. The population of Tarwin Lower in 2016 was 358 people. By 2021 the population was 462 showing a population growth of 29.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Tarwin Lower is 60-69 years. Households in Tarwin Lower are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Tarwin Lower work in a managers occupation.In 2021, 88.40% of the homes in Tarwin Lower were owner-occupied compared with 81.70% in 2016.
